A genetic discovery will make treatment for Crohn\u2019s disease and ulcerative colitis safer, by identifying patients who are at risk of potentially deadly drug side effects.<\/span>
\nA ground-breaking and large-scale NHS research collaboration, led by the University of Exeter and the Royal Devon & Exeter NHS Foundation Trust, has discovered a gene mutation that allows the identification of patients at risk of a drug side effect, allowing clinicians to tailor alternative treatments to these individuals.<\/span>
\nThis finding will reduce the risk of drug side effects caused by treatment with thiopurines (consisting of azathioprine and mercaptopurine). This group of drugs is commonly used for the treatment of autoimmune and inflammatory diseases.<\/span>
\nCrohn\u2019s disease and ulcerative colitis (collectively known as inflammatory bowel disease \u2013IBD) are incurable lifelong conditions that affect approximately 1 in 150 people in the UK. The main symptoms are urgent diarrhoea, often with rectal bleeding, abdominal pain, profound fatigue and weight loss. The condition disrupts people\u2019s education, working, social and family life. Drugs to suppress the immune system are the mainstay of treatment, however more than half of patients with Crohn\u2019s Disease and about 20 per cent of patients with ulcerative colitis will require surgery at some point. The lifetime medical costs associated with the care of a person with IBD are similar to the costs of treating diabetes or cancer.<\/span>
\nAbout a third of patients with IBD are treated with a thiopurine drug, however, approximately 7 per cent of patients develop an adverse reaction called \u201cbone marrow suppression\u201d. This means that the body\u2019s immune system is less able to fight infection and patients are at risk of sepsis.<\/span>
\nPrevious studies have identified mutations in a gene known as TPMT, which predisposes patients to thiopurine-induced bone marrow suppression. Clinicians either adjust the dose or avoid thiopurines altogether if routine tests show that patients are likely to carry faulty versions of the TPMT gene. However, only a quarter of patients who suffer from bone-marrow suppression have abnormalities in TPMT, suggesting that other genes may be involved.<\/span>
\nThrough the National Institute of Health Research Clinical Research Network, 82 NHS hospitals in the UK recruited patients to the study. In addition patients were recruited from international collaborators in the Netherlands, USA, Australia, France, New Zealand, South Africa, Malta, Denmark, Sweden, Italy and Canada. The Exeter IBD Research Group also recruited UK patients via the Medicines and Healthcare products Regulatory Agency (MHRA) Yellow Card Scheme, which collects reports of patients who have experienced complications of treatment.<\/span>
\nDNA from approximately 500 patients with IBD that suffered thiopurine-induced bone marrow suppression and 680 controls (IBD patients who had received thiopurines and had no history of bone marrow suppression), were analysed to identify genes possibly associated with this adverse drug reaction.<\/span>
\nThe researchers found an association between mutations in a gene called NUDT15 and bone marrow suppression. This gene mutation had previously only been thought important in patients of East Asian descent.<\/span>
\nChief Investigator of the study, Dr Tariq Ahmad, of the University of Exeter Medical School, said: \u201cIn the largest genetic analysis into the side effects of thiopurine drugs we\u2019ve discovered variation in a gene that can help us identify who is susceptible to thiopurine-induced bone marrow suppression. In line with the NHS 10 year plan to increase personalised medicine, testing for this genetic abnormality prior to prescribing thiopurine drugs will reduce the risks to patients, and costs to the NHS, associated with this potentially serious drug side effect.<\/span><\/p>\n
